From: Chris Gelardi

To Whom It May Concern:

Pursuant to the New York Freedom of Information Law, I hereby request the following records:

All final investigative reports compiled by the Internal Affairs Bureau regarding complaints against Suffolk County Police Department Detective Ronald Tavares.

The requested documents will be made available to the general public, and this request is not being made for commercial purposes.

In the event that there are fees, I would be grateful if you would inform me of the total charges in advance of fulfilling my request. I would prefer the request filled electronically, by e-mail attachment if available or CD-ROM if not.

Thank you in advance for your anticipated cooperation in this matter. I look forward to receiving your response to this request within 5 business days, as the statute requires.

Sincerely,

Chris Gelardi

From: Suffolk County Police Department

Chris,

First and foremost, allow me to apologize for the inordinate delay and response to your request, which was submitted in July of 2022; your request was received, but it appears that it was not properly acknowledged. That being said, I offer my sincerest apology.

The Suffolk County Police Department, as you may know, suffered a crippling "cyber event" in September of 2022; some of our systems were offline until January of 2023, and some still remain offline.

The request for all IAB Complaints involving former Suffolk Detective Ronald Tavares was forwarded to I.A.B., however, as stated above, their systems were impacted by the "cyber event" as well.

I assure you that your request is pending and ask that you remain patient while we work through the requests in the order of receipt. As, I am sure you can appreciate, there is a significant backlog of requests due to the cyber event.

If you have any questions or wish to amend, modify or rescind your request, please do so in writing.

Thank you, in advance, for your anticipated consideration.
